summaryrefslogtreecommitdiff
path: root/includes/sys_template.php
diff options
context:
space:
mode:
authorPhilip Häusler <msquare@notrademark.de>2011-12-26 15:55:17 +0100
committerPhilip Häusler <msquare@notrademark.de>2011-12-26 15:55:17 +0100
commitd1078f60fdb2237b1a3bfe0b664da1a5e7425d1f (patch)
tree7e2245fe2267b1fb0006228515b4acead4f9eb2b /includes/sys_template.php
parentce7f071c38202764f43eded4c3157a4743bd545f (diff)
#44 new register form
Diffstat (limited to 'includes/sys_template.php')
-rw-r--r--includes/sys_template.php20
1 files changed, 15 insertions, 5 deletions
diff --git a/includes/sys_template.php b/includes/sys_template.php
index 4af22500..0a42d9ac 100644
--- a/includes/sys_template.php
+++ b/includes/sys_template.php
@@ -49,6 +49,14 @@ function form_text($name, $label, $value, $disabled = false) {
}
/**
+ * Rendert ein Formular-Passwortfeld
+ */
+function form_password($name, $label, $disabled = false) {
+ $disabled = $disabled ? ' disabled="disabled"' : '';
+ return form_element($label, '<input id="form_' . $name . '" type="password" name="' . $name . '" value="" ' . $disabled . '/>', 'form_' . $name);
+}
+
+/**
* Rendert ein Formular-Textfeld
*/
function form_textarea($name, $label, $value, $disabled = false) {
@@ -168,13 +176,15 @@ function html_options($name, $options, $selected = "") {
return $html;
}
-function html_select_key($name, $rows, $selected) {
- $html = '<select name="' . $name . '">';
- foreach ($rows as $key => $row)
- if (($key == $selected) || ($row == $selected))
+function html_select_key($id, $name, $rows, $selected) {
+ $html = '<select id="' . $id . '" name="' . $name . '">';
+ foreach ($rows as $key => $row) {
+ if (($key == $selected) || ($row == $selected)) {
$html .= '<option value="' . $key . '" selected="selected">' . $row . '</option>';
- else
+ } else {
$html .= '<option value="' . $key . '">' . $row . '</option>';
+ }
+ }
$html .= '</select>';
return $html;
}